India took on South Africa in the Final of the T20 World Cup 2024 at the Kensington Oval in Barbados on June 29. India won the toss and opted to bat first. Rohit Sharma and Rishabh Pant walked back after falling cheaply. Suryakumar Yadav did not replicate his last match heroics and Virat Kohli found a solid partner in the form of Axar Patel when India were reeling on 34 for 3. The duo put up a match-defining partnership of 72 runs for the fourth wicket.

Virat trudged back after a marvellous 76 off 59 and Axar was run out on well made 47 off 31 balls. Sivam Dube who was out of form throughout the tournament played a handy knock of 27 off 16 as India posted a defendable target of 176 for 7 on the board. For South Africa, Keshav Maharaj and Anrich Nortje contributed with two wickets each.

While chasing, South Africa were put under pressure as Reeza Hendricks and Aiden Markram were sent packing for four runs each. Quinton de Kock and Tristan Stubbs brought the Proteas back in the game as they shared 68 runs between them for the third wicket. After Stubbs departed scoring 31 off 21, Heinrich Klaasen gave nightmares to Indian bowlers as he smashed the likes of Kuldeep Yadav and Axar Patel like a walk in the park.

De Kock was dismissed on 39 off 21 and Klaasen continued his onslaught until Hardik Pandya made him nick one to the keeper in the 17 over, he scored a blistering 52 off 27.  Jasprit Bumrah and Arshdeep Singh were economical at death picking wickets each. But it all boiled down to Pandya bowling the last over with 16 runs to defend and David Miller on strike. He picked on the first ball and sent Rabada packing and India won the Final by seven runs.
